View 2 Photos View 0 Videos Used ECM For Caterpillar 3406C Contact for price USED ECM FOR CATERPILLAR 3406C, Core Charge: 0.00 ConditionUsedStock Number53059 MLS Number10275771CategoryEngine Control Modules (ECM)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 4 Photos View 0 Videos Used 40 Pin ECM Compatible For Caterpillar 3406E And C12 $650 USD USED 40 PIN ECM COMPATIBLE FOR CATERPILLAR 3406E AND C12, Core Charge: 0.00 ConditionUsedStock Number34820 MLS Number10275755CategoryEngine Control Modules (ECM)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 2 Photos View 0 Videos Used Engine Caterpillar 3406 ECM Contact for price USED ENGINE CATERPILLAR 3406 ECM ., Core Charge: 0.00 ConditionUsedStock Number14530 MLS Number10275754CategoryEngine Control Modules (ECM)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 4 Photos View 0 Videos Used ECM For Caterpillar 3406 Engine Contact for price USED ECM FOR CATERPILLAR 3406 ENGINE., Core Charge: 0.00 ConditionUsedStock Number12759 MLS Number10275748CategoryEngine Control Modules (ECM)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 3 Photos View 0 Videos Used Engine ECM For Caterpillar 3406C $300 USD USED ENGINE ECM FOR CATERPILLAR 3406C, Core Charge: 0.00 ConditionUsedStock Number10286 MLS Number10275727CategoryEngine Control Modules (ECM)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 2 Photos View 0 Videos Used Idler Gear For Caterpillar 3406E Contact for price USED IDLER GEAR FOR CATERPILLAR 3406E, Core Charge: 0.00 ConditionUsedStock Number52949 MLS Number10273791C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 2 Photos View 0 Videos Used Idler Gear For Caterpillar 3406E Contact for price USED IDLER GEAR FOR CATERPILLAR 3406E, Core Charge: 0.00 ConditionUsedStock Number52944 MLS Number10273705C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 3 Photos View 0 Videos CAT 3406B Engine Control Module Contact for price CAT 3406B ENGINE CONTROL MODULE., Core Charge: 0.00 ConditionUsedStock Number52414 MLS Number10273677C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 3 Photos View 0 Videos Used Rocker Housing For Caterpillar 3406B $75 USD USED ROCKER HOUSING FOR CATERPILLAR 3406B, Core Charge: 0.00 ConditionUsedStock Number50903 MLS Number10273556C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 6 Photos View 0 Videos Used Timing Gear For A Caterpillar Engine 3406B With Idler Shaft $75 USD USED TIMING GEAR FOR A CATERPILLAR ENGINE 3406B WITH IDLER SHAFT, Core Charge: 0.00 ConditionUsedStock Number50358 MLS Number10273476C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 2 Photos View 0 Videos New O-Ring Gasket Kit For CAT Engines 3406, 3408, And 3412 $27 USD NEW O-RING GASKET KIT FOR CAT ENGINES 3406, 3408, AND 3412., Core Charge: 0.00 ConditionNewStock Number14445 MLS Number10273224C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 1 Photo View 0 Videos Caterpillar 3406B Dip Stick Tube Contact for price CATERPILLAR 3406B DIP STICK TUBE, Core Charge: 0.00 ConditionUsedStock Number13853 MLS Number10273207C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 2 Photos View 0 Videos Caterpillar 3406B Engine Eye-Lift Contact for price CATERPILLAR 3406B ENGINE EYE-LIFT, Core Charge: 0.00 ConditionUsedStock Number13854 MLS Number10273166C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 3 Photos View 0 Videos Used Intake Elbow For A Caterpillar 3406E $60 USD USED INTAKE ELBOW FOR A CATERPILLAR 3406E, Core Charge: 0.00 ConditionUsedStock Number14042 MLS Number10273164C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 3 Photos View 0 Videos Caterpillar 3406 Engine Lift Bracket. 4-BOLT, Square Mounting Pattern Contact for price CATERPILLAR 3406 ENGINE LIFT BRACKET. 4-BOLT, SQUARE MOUNTING PATTERN., Core Charge: 0.00 ConditionUsedStock Number11783 MLS Number10272982C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 4 Photos View 0 Videos Caterpillar 3406E Oil Cooler Bonnet Contact for price CATERPILLAR 3406E OIL COOLER BONNET., Core Charge: 0.00 ConditionUsedStock Number11435 MLS Number10272967C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 4 Photos View 0 Videos Caterpillar 3406 Oil Cooler Bonnet Contact for price CATERPILLAR 3406 OIL COOLER BONNET., Core Charge: 0.00 ConditionUsedStock Number11078 MLS Number10272926C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 1 Photo View 0 Videos Intake Manifold Elbow From A Caterpillar 3406E Engine Contact for price INTAKE MANIFOLD ELBOW FROM A CATERPILLAR 3406E ENGINE., Core Charge: 0.00 ConditionUsedStock Number11438 MLS Number10272886C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 2 Photos View 0 Videos CAT 3406E Oil Cooler Elbow Contact for price CAT 3406E OIL COOLER ELBOW., Core Charge: 0.00 ConditionUsedStock Number10732 MLS Number10272870C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 3 Photos View 0 Videos Caterpillar 3406B Water Pump Cover Contact for price CATERPILLAR 3406B WATER PUMP COVER., Core Charge: 0.00 ConditionUsedStock Number10368 MLS Number10272843C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 4 Photos View 0 Videos CAT 3406E Fuel Filter Base With Bracket And Seperate Fuel Filter Housing Contact for price CAT 3406E FUEL FILTER BASE WITH BRACKET AND SEPERATE FUEL FILTER HOUSING ATTACHED., Core Charge: 0.00 ConditionUsedStock Number7458 MLS Number10272816C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 3 Photos View 0 Videos Caterpillar 3406 14.6L Thermostat Housing Contact for price CATERPILLAR 3406 14.6L THERMOSTAT HOUSING., Core Charge: 0.00 ConditionUsedStock Number7916 MLS Number10272807C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 3 Photos View 0 Videos Caterpillar 3406E 14.6L Engine Oil Filter Base Contact for price CATERPILLAR 3406E 14.6L ENGINE OIL FILTER BASE., Core Charge: 0.00 ConditionUsedStock Number7615 MLS Number10272806C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 3 Photos View 0 Videos Caterpillar 3406 Engine Air Connection Tube Contact for price CATERPILLAR 3406 ENGINE AIR CONNECTION TUBE., Core Charge: 0.00 ConditionUsedStock Number7264 MLS Number10272780C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info
View 1 Photo View 0 Videos Engine/Turbo Exhaust Elbow From CAT 3406 Contact for price Engine/Turbo exhaust elbow from CAT 3406., Core Charge: 0.00 ConditionUsedStock Number5208 MLS Number10272567CategoryEngine Miscellaneous Parts Last Updated12/22/2025 LocationPhoenix, AZ, US Sold ByAmerican Truck Sales & Salvage (844) 882-___ SHOWNUMBERCall Seller Email Seller Save More Info